Smilodon populator was the largest of saber-toothed tigers. Weight: 220-400 kg. Height at shoulders: to 1.2 m. Length: to 2.6 m (without the tail) Tail length: 30 cm. Length of canines: 30 cm – they jutted from the upper jaw at 17 cm. Occurrence: 1 m – 10,000 years ago.Did saber tooth tigers eat humans? It's easy to imagine that saber-tooth cats hunted the way today's tigers do -- after all, many people call the extinct felines "saber-tooth tigers." Tigers hunt alone, waiting until twilight and using vegetation or patches of light and shadow to hide themselves. A tiger will stalk its prey until it's close enough to strike in a couple of quick ... Living over 40 million years before the sabre-tooth tiger, Diegoaelurus vanvalkenburghae may have preyed on rhinos and primates in the forests of California. With serrated teeth and an all meat-diet, you wouldn't want to mess with Diegoaelurus vanvalkenburghae.
